I'm not agreeing with "worse version of Obsidian", but Obsidian with Syncthing works great for p2p synchronisation.
loics2
I don't think it's necessarily the job of the developers, the main issue IMO is that there's not enough involvement from other specialists such as designers in open-source communities.
This is not a problem with people, but with UX design.
We don't need a corporation to have usable interfaces. Right now, if you visit join-lemmy.org, the main focus is for people wanting to host an instance, which is only a small part of the advanced user base. The common user won't care about the fact Lemmy is made with rust or that there's a docker image.
I don't think it's only an issue with Lemmy, lots of open-source projects lack user-friendliness and onboarding.
Once the app is open-sourced, I'd happily contribute to stuff like this
Oh nice! I wasn't aware. So my suggestion would be to change the default maybe, if enough people think the same
The problem already exists now, having oauth wouldn't change anything.
Zypper